Among the noteworthy advantages of polished concrete flooring surfaces in these times of environmental responsibility is the sustainability factor. Having a minimal effect on the environment is a key characteristic of sealed and polished concrete. In houses which are built on a concrete base (as most are), there isn't any need for additional flooring materials, just the sanding down, sealing and polishing of the pre-existing concrete floor. Also very few chemical vapours are released by the substances used in polished concrete flooring, thus the internal air quality and the outside environment is not harmed by the process. There's also no permanent smell released by the substances polishing and sealing sealing and polishing concrete flooring.

Concrete is also a really cost effective material for flooring. For a long time concrete has stood out as the most cost effective flooring solution on the market. As most houses in Claygate are in reality built on top of huge slabs of concrete, the main flooring foundation is already installed. The more exposed flooring materials of vinyl, tile, timber and carpet are merely installed over it. There is very little more affordable than an existing floor surface that merely needs preparing. Polished concrete remains cool throughout the summer time lowering the requirement for expensive air-conditioning. The highly reflective qualities of polished concrete surfaces could also reduce the necessity for internal lighting, therefore allowing you to save more expense.

Polished concrete is appealing because it requires little maintenance, a fantastic plus point. Continuous cleaning is necessary with most popular floor materials. As an example wooden flooring needs waxing and polishing, marble floors are susceptible to scuffing and require chemical cleaners and carpets must be frequently vacuumed. In comparison a polished concrete floor is highly resistant to scratching and tarnishing, and most of the time merely requires a quick mopping. Together with the added practicalities and convenience of this, time and effort will also be saved.
There is no doubt that one of the principal benefits of concrete floors is the durability aspect. It's no surprise that some of the most durable floors in Claygate are made of concrete. Scientific analysis carried out by legitimate sources signifies that a concrete floor may last for a minimum of one hundred years if it is correctly treated. For that reason, those people in the know in Claygate have for some time made use of this sort of floor surface for busy areas like office blocks, retail outlets, commercial spaces, salons, bars and shopping centres. Decay and moisture damage is hardly ever a problem since the concrete is able to "breathe". Tiles or vinyl for example are inclined to trap moisture leading to costly replacements and repairs, which can be avoided with concrete.
Probably one of the less recognised benefits of concrete flooring, is the health factor. Dust mites have for many years been known to lead to allergies, problems with breathing and other medical conditions. The deep pile of carpets and the cutouts and joints of tiles and wooden floorboards are prime locations for contaminants, bacteria and germs. The plus point with polished concrete flooring is that the final finished surfaces are smooth and seamless and there is nowhere for those things to gather. For property owners in Claygate hoping to create an allergy-free zone, polished concrete floors are certainly an option to consider.

Plenty of options are available to home owners in Claygate, due to the fact that concrete is a very adaptive material. The various treatments and stains which are readily available means that you can generate any look that you want. For instance, home owners who are looking for the traditional "wet" look, can accomplish this with the use of penetrating silicon based sealers. A faux tile pattern is a widely used style for polished concrete. If the chosen effect is floor boards a timber plank design can be imprinted into the concrete. A remarkable result is obtained by laying bare a cross section of the aggregate stones by means of diamond grinding.

Concrete Floor Repair
The widespread use of concrete floors in industrial and commercial buildings is owing to their durability and longevity. However, even the toughest of floors can become damaged over time, leading to the need for repairs. There are several reasons why concrete flooring may need to be repaired, such as spalling, cracks, and uneven surfaces.
From basic patching and resurfacing to intricate methods like concrete grinding and polishing, repairing concrete floors can involve a range of techniques. The secret of successful concrete floor repair is identifying the underlying cause of the damage and selecting the appropriate repair strategy.
Using epoxy coatings or sealers is a widely used method for repairing concrete flooring. These materials are applied to the surface of the floor to fill in cracks and gaps and provide a protective layer against future damage. Another popular technique is concrete grinding and polishing, which can help to level out uneven surfaces and create a smooth, polished finish.
Regardless of the scope or size of the repair, it's vital to engage a skilled flooring specialist to guarantee that the work is done safely and correctly. Proper repair of a concrete floor can help to extend its lifespan and ensure that it remains functional for many years to come.
What are the Main Repairs That Might be Needed to a Concrete Floor?
Some common repairs for a concrete floor include:
- Spalling repair: Flaking or peeling off of the surface layer of a concrete floor characterizes spalling. This can be due to improper installation, exposure to harsh weather, or heavy usage. Removing the damaged layer and applying a new surface layer are necessary for spalling repair.
- Joint repair: Damage to joints can occur due to wear and tear, exposure to chemicals, or extreme temperatures. Joints are the spaces between two concrete slabs. To repair joints, a suitable material is used to fill the gaps.
- Sealing: Sealing a concrete floor helps to protect it from moisture and damage caused by chemicals, grease or oil. Regular sealing is an effective way to extend the lifespan of a concrete floor and avoid the need for repairs.
- Uneven surface repair: Creating safety hazards and causing additional damage, an uneven surface can be problematic. Repairing uneven surfaces may involve the use of floor levelling or grinding techniques.
- Crack repair: Cracks in a concrete floor can occur due to various reasons such as shifting soil, temperature changes or heavy loads. Preventing further damage caused by expanding cracks requires their repair, making it essential.
By dealing with any underlying issues that may be causing the damage to the concrete floor, future damage and the need for repairs in the future can be avoided.
Is Polished Concrete Cheaper Than Tiling?
When comparing polished concrete and tiling, cost is a major factor, but it's not always straightforward. Polished concrete can generally be cheaper than tiling, particularly if there's an existing concrete slab. The process involves grinding, polishing, and sealing the concrete, cutting out the need for extra materials like tiles or adhesives. This can significantly reduce costs, making polished concrete an attractive choice for those on a budget.

That said, the cost comparison really relies on several key factors. The price for tiling varies depending on the kind of tiles you decide to use - basic ceramic tiles tend to be more affordable, whereas opting for intricate designs or natural stone can significantly increase the total cost. Moreover, labour costs for tiling can add up, as it takes time to place each tile accurately. On the other hand, polished concrete might involve a higher upfront investment, especially if your current slab needs extensive work, but it generally requires less maintenance over time.
At the end of the day, both polished concrete and tiling have their own benefits, and the right choice depends on your priorities. For a sleek, modern finish that's tough and easy to maintain, polished concrete is hard to beat. If, however, you're after something with more variety - like vibrant colours, patterns, and textures - tiling could be worth the extra investment. Take a moment to consider your budget and requirements to choose the best option for your space. (Tags: Polished Concrete Vs Tiling).

Granolithic Concrete Flooring Claygate
To make granolithic concrete flooring, which is highly durable, one mixes cement, sand, and granite or other tough aggregates. Known for its strength, it is frequently used in places with heavy footfall, such as garages, warehouses, and factories. For places that demand a robust, long-lasting surface, this style of flooring is ideal.

One significant benefit of granolithic flooring is that it resists damage and wear effectively. Adding granite or hard stone to the mix makes it considerably stronger than standard concrete, enabling it to withstand heavy loads and frequent use without the risk of chipping or cracking. This makes it an excellent choice for both commercial and industrial settings.
Installing the flooring involves spreading the concrete mixture onto the surface and levelling it to ensure an even finish. The concrete must cure and harden once laid, and only then can it be polished to achieve a smooth and sleek appearance. A floor that is both low-maintenance and highly durable is achieved through a process that requires professional skills.
These floors, made of granolithic concrete, are practical and can also be made aesthetically pleasing. To provide a sleek, modern finish, they can be polished or coloured, rendering them appropriate for more than just industrial environments. By providing the right care, these floors can last for numerous years, delivering a durable and attractive surface. (Tags: Granolithic Concrete Flooring Claygate)
Terrazzo Flooring
Terrazzo flooring is a popular flooring option because it is elegant, durable and distinctive. This flooring, which originated in Italy during the fifteenth century, is a much sought-after choice for both commercial and residential spaces in Claygate, and it has only become more popular over time.

The materials used to make terrazzo flooring include quartz, marble chips, glass pieces, and other aggregates, which are embedded in a binder, usually epoxy resin or cement. This blend of aggregates and binder creates a surface that is both versatile and visually captivating. The flooring surface is then ground and polished to achieve a glossy and smooth finish.
Among terrazzo flooring's standout features is the flexibility it offers in design. The wide array of aggregate choices and colours available allows for customisation to suit any aesthetic or interior design scheme. Given its versatility, it finds suitability in a wide array of spaces, such as historic buildings, modern office settings, retail environments, and contemporary residential properties in Claygate.
They're not just about appearance! Terrazzo floors are tremendously long-lasting and tough. A strong and resilient surface, formed by the combination of binders and aggregates, is capable of withstanding heavy footfall and meeting the demands of commercial settings. Due to its exceptional resilience against scratches, stains, and everyday wear and tear, terrazzo stands out as a fantastic investment for the long term.
One factor that makes terrazzo flooring extremely popular is its low maintenance requirements. Usually, a combination of frequent sweeping and occasional mopping is sufficient to keep the flooring looking beautiful. Cleaning tasks are easier because its non-porous surface additionally prevents stains and liquids from seeping in.
Installing terrazzo flooring is a craft that requires a considerable amount of skill. It includes pouring the mixture onto the subfloor and then grinding and polishing it to reach the desired finish. The finished product is a smooth, seamless surface that looks as if it flows through the space. Although installing terrazzo may be more complex than some other flooring alternatives, its longevity and visual impact make it well worth the effort.
Recent years have seen a marked resurgence of terrazzo flooring in interior design trends. The capacity to infuse a sense of timeless elegance while still preserving a modern edge has drawn the interest of designers, property owners, and architects. Its presence in upscale homes, high-end establishments, and art galleries is a testament to its versatility and enduring appeal.
To conclude, terrazzo flooring stands out as a visually striking, durable, and versatile flooring option, ideal for use in both homes and commercial spaces in Claygate. Looking for a flooring option that is both unique and durable? Its easy maintenance, rich history, and design flexibility certainly make it a choice worth considering. Be it in the halls of historical landmarks or the sleek interiors of contemporary spaces, terrazzo flooring is still celebrated for its sophistication and exceptional craftsmanship.
